Lincoln is a spirited Golden Retriever from Tennessee who has built a devoted following thanks to his loyal heart and expressive eyes. A regular at the Pleasant View Pet Spa and Country Boarding Retreat, Lincoln thrives on his structured daycare routine. But one unexpected afternoon transformed his regular schedule into an emotional scene that tugs at the heart.
Every Monday, Wednesday, and Friday, Lincoln eagerly bounds into the daycare. The familiar scents, bounding friends, and loving staff bring comfort and excitement. While other days are for backyard lounging and family adventures, daycare days are a highlight for this peppy pup.
On this particular day, Lincoln’s morning unfolded just like all the others. He played joyfully among his daycare pals, soaking up attention and energy in equal measure. The afternoon passed in a familiar rhythm—until pickup time rolled around—and Lincoln found himself alone.
Meghan, Lincoln’s human, usually picks him up around 5:15 PM. But that day, a late work call caused a delay. As the minutes ticked by, more dogs left, each with a happy reunion. The room, once full of wagging tails, grew quiet. Eventually, Lincoln was the only one left.
Still in the care of a trusted handler named Holly, Lincoln sat quietly, but something in his demeanor shifted. The usually buoyant retriever slowly rested his head and let his body fall into a tender posture of sorrow. Caught on the daycare’s security camera, the moment was raw and utterly touching.
Holly stayed with him, gently wrapping her arms around Lincoln, offering quiet reassurance. There was no barking or whining—just a still, poignant silence as Lincoln seemingly asked, “Where is Mom?” His body language spoke volumes, capturing the emotions that so many can relate to: waiting, uncertainty, and the fear of being forgotten.
The moment was shared on TikTok, and it didn’t take long for people around the world to connect with Lincoln’s experience. Viewers posted heartfelt comments, many recalling how it felt to be the last child picked up at school—drawing a parallel to the loneliness Lincoln must have felt in that moment.

When Meghan arrived just before closing time, Lincoln’s mood lifted instantly. He sprinted toward her, tail wagging, his sadness washed away in a flood of reunion joy. Though the experience had visibly affected him, Lincoln bore no grudge. Instead, he gave his mom his whole heart, as dogs always do.
That night, Lincoln was treated to his favorite delights: cuddles on the couch, a creamy pup cup, and all the love a Golden could hope for. Meghan couldn’t help but feel a pang of guilt, but Lincoln forgave without hesitation.
Lincoln’s story is about more than a delayed pickup. It’s a glimpse into the emotional depth that dogs carry with them. Their understanding may not be verbal, but their feelings run deep.
